Musical theatre stars have surprised shoppers in Eldon Square with a sneak preview of their upcoming performance of Annie.

Actors from the Newcastle-Upon-Tyne Musical Theatre Company have been warming up for their summer show by singing a selection of favourites from the well-known musical.

The company, which has been running for more than a century, produces a show at Newcastle's Theatre Royal every year.

Previous shows include 42nd Street in 2011, The King And I in 2010 and The Producers in 2009.

Performers of all ages will be taking part in the 2012 production of Annie, which will see 60 performers take to the stage.

Picture: Newcastle Musical Theatre Company Have Chosen Annie For Their 2012 Production

A lengthy audition process earlier in the year saw 130 young girls audition for the role of Annie.

The show's Daddy Warbucks, Gareth Lilley from Fenham, has been forced to sacrifice his hair ahead of the production.

The 32-year-old underwent a full head shave with cut-throat razors at Newcastle barbers Ordian in order to prepare for the role.

Annie will be performed at the Theatre Royal between August 28 and September 1, 2012.
